Late Lilac, Villous Lilac Syringa villosa
Prices start at : 3.95 USD / 1 packet

* White or rosy-lilac flowers in 3-7" clusters, often several to each branch tip, in May; flower fragrance, not intense, resembles privet; very hardy; forms a dense, arching shrub with substantial branches; does well in the U.S. Midwest; native to China.

Fragrant Winterhazel Corylopsis glabrescens
Prices start at : 8.95 USD / 1 packet

* A shrub grown for its pale yellow, fragrant flowers in spring before leaves emerge; part or full sun; leaves dark green, gold or yellow-green in fall; Japan native. Flower buds are susceptible to damage from early spring frosts.
